كان موضوع أوبونتو GTK التقليدي موجودًاإلى الأبد وهو مؤرخ. التصميم قديم ، وحتى مع مظهر 18.04 المحدث ، فهو ليس الأفضل. لهذا السبب في هذه المقالة ، سنتناول كيفية التبديل إلى مفترق Ambiance الحديث: موضوع Flattiance GTK.
موضوع Flattiance GTK متاح حاليًاعلى Github وأداة Git هي الطريقة المفضلة لتثبيته لأنه يمكن استخدامه بسهولة لتنزيل أحدث إصدار من السمة على الفور ، بدلاً من الاضطرار إلى تنزيل كل شيء يدويًا.
تثبيت Flattiance GTK الموضوع
لبدء استخدام السمة ، ستحتاج إلى تنزيل وتثبيت جميع التبعيات التي يحتاجها Flattiance ليتم عرضها على Linux بشكل صحيح.
ملاحظة: يعتبر Flattiance سمة Ubuntu بشكل أساسي ، لكن هذا لا يعني أنه لا يمكن استخدامها في توزيعات Linux الأخرى أيضًا. للحصول على أفضل النتائج ، اتبع طريقة التثبيت Git.
تثبيت عبر بوابة

يتطلب Flattiance تجميع قبل التثبيت. للتجميع ، ستحتاج إلى تثبيت بعض الحزم المهمة. افتح نافذة طرفية وأدخل الأمر التالي في أوبونتو.
sudo apt install git inkscape libglib2.0-dev-bin git nodejs gtk2-engines-murrine gtk2-engines-pixbuf
ضع في اعتبارك أن القائمة الكاملة المطلوبةتبعيات Flattiance غير معروفة لأن المطور لا يحددها على Github. إذا كان الأمر كذلك ، فلا تحاول تشغيل البرنامج النصي للبناء. بدلاً من ذلك ، قم بتثبيت السمة المدمجة مسبقًا في Git repo.
للاستيلاء على أحدث رمز موضوع Flattiance ، قم بتشغيل بوابة استنساخ
git clone https://github.com/IonicaBizau/Flattiance
باستخدام القرص المضغوط الأمر ، انتقل إلى دليل سمة Flattiance الذي تم إنشاؤه حديثًا.
cd Flattiance
إذا كنت ترغب في إنشاء السمة من البداية ، فقم بتشغيل الأمر build.
./build
إذا كان البناء ناجحًا ، فسيتم تلقائيًاتثبيت السمة وتطبيقه. إذا فشل هذا ، فستحتاج إلى التخلي عن عملية البناء وتثبيت ملفات السمات المضمنة بدلاً من ذلك. تبدأ من خلال الحصول على قذيفة الجذر في المحطة. في أوبونتو ، لا يمكن استخدامه سو خارج الصندوق ، لأغراض أمنية. بدلاً من ذلك ، ستحتاج إلى اكتساب الجذر sudo-s.
الحصول على جذر قذيفة ، بدلا من استخدام الفرد سودو الأوامر هي أكثر كفاءة. كما يجب أن تتغلب على أي أخطاء إذن مزعج.
sudo -s
استعمال فيديو موسيقي لنقل المجلد الفرعي Flattiance إلى المجلد / البيرة / حصة / المواضيع / مجال نظام الملفات.
mv Flattiance /usr/share/themes/
الآن بعد أن أصبح Flattiance في المكان الصحيح ، تم تثبيت السمة. عن طريق خروج، تسجيل الخروج من الجذر. ثم استخدم جمهورية مقدونيا الأمر لحذف أي الملفات المتبقية.
exit rm ~/Flattiance
تحتاج إلى إلغاء تثبيت موضوع Flattiance؟ تشغيل جمهورية مقدونيا أمر.
su rm -rf /usr/share/themes/Flattiance
تثبيت للحصول على مستخدم واحد
لا يلزم تثبيت Flattiance على مستوى النظام. من الممكن تمكينه لمستخدم واحد في المرة الواحدة. للقيام بذلك ، فإن الخطوة الأولى هي الحصول على شفرة المصدر كما تفعل عادةً.
git clone https://github.com/IonicaBizau/Flattiance
أدخل مجلد التنزيل مع القرص المضغوط.
cd Flattiance
تجنب أداة البناء ، وبدلاً من ذلك ، انقل السمة المعدة مسبقًا إلى ~ / .themes مجلد.
mkdir -p ~/.themes mv Flattiance ~/.themes
وضع Flattiance في هذا الدليل ، بدلاً من دليل سمة النظام ، يعني فقط المستخدمين الذين لديهم هذا المظهر ~ / .themes يمكن استخدامها. كرر هذه العملية عدة مرات كما هو مطلوب لتمكينها لعدة مستخدمين.
ملاحظة: قم بإلغاء تثبيت Flattiance with جمهورية مقدونيا.
rm -rf ~/.themes/Flattiance rm -rf ~/Flattiance
تثبيت عبر NPM
طريقة أخرى لتثبيت Flattiance GTKالسمة هي مع أداة NodeJS NPM. يعد استخدام هذا الطريق مفيدًا لمستخدمي Ubuntu الذين لا يرغبون في التعامل مع Git. للتثبيت ، تأكد من تثبيت أحدث إصدار من NodeJS ، وكذلك NPM ، على Ubuntu.
curl -sL https://deb.nodesource.com/setup_8.x | sudo -E bash - sudo apt-get install -y nodejs
مع تثبيت Node ، استخدم أداة حزمة NPM للحصول على أحدث سمة Flattiance على Ubuntu.
npm install --global flattiance
تمكين موضوع Flattiance GTK

هدف Flattiance الرئيسي هو استبدال Ubuntuموضوع أجواء. إنه يبلغ من العمر عامًا ويركز بشكل أساسي على Unity 7. ومع ذلك ، فإنه سيعمل أيضًا مع Gnome وغيرها من أجهزة سطح المكتب GTK على Ubuntu. لتمكين السمة على Ubuntu ، ستحتاج إلى تثبيت تطبيق Gnome Tweak Tool.
sudo apt install gnome-tweak-tool
بمجرد تثبيت ، اضغط على مفتاح ويندوز علىلوحة المفاتيح ، اكتب "القرص" وافتح البرنامج الذي يظهر. من هناك ، ستحتاج إلى النقر على "المظهر". انظر من خلال خيارات المظهر وتمكين Flattiance.
بدلاً من ذلك ، إذا كنت لا تزال تستخدم الوحدة 7 ، فقم بتمكين السمة في الجهاز باستخدام:
gsettings set org.gnome.desktop.interface gtk-theme "Flattiance"
تمكين Flattiance على أجهزة سطح المكتب الأخرى
إذا كنت تحب مظهر هذا المظهر وكنت كذلكباستخدام Ubuntu ، ولكن ليس سطح المكتب الرئيسي الذي ستظل قادرًا على تمكين هذا المظهر. نظرًا لأن هذا الموضوع قائم على GTK ، يجب أن يعمل Flattiance بشكل مثالي على Ubuntu Mate و Xubuntu و Lubuntu و Ubuntu Budgie.
تحقق من أدلةنا العميقة لهذه المكاتب أدناه:
- قرفة
- جنوم شل
- LXDE
- زميل
- الببغاء
- XFCE4
تعليقات